Look for Entry-Level Jobs
Entry-level jobs are great for beginners. They don’t need much experience. Look for these jobs in your area. Ask friends or family if they know of any openings.
Common Entry-level Jobs
Job | Description |
---|---|
Retail Assistant | Help customers in stores. |
Food Service Worker | Work in restaurants or cafes. |
Office Assistant | Help with paperwork and emails. |

Volunteer to Gain Experience
Volunteering is a great way to gain experience. It shows you are willing to work. Plus, you learn new skills. These skills can help you get a job.
Places To Volunteer
- Animal shelters
- Local libraries
- Community centers
Prepare a Simple Resume
A resume is important. It shows what you can do. Keep it simple. Include your skills and education. You can also add any volunteer work you have done.
Resume Tips
- Use clear language
- Include contact information
- List skills and education
Practice for Interviews
Interviews can be scary. But practice makes it easier. Think of questions they might ask. Practice answering them. This will help you feel confident.
Common Interview Questions
- Tell me about yourself.
- Why do you want this job?
- What are your strengths?
Follow Up After Interviews
Always follow up after an interview. This shows you are interested. Send a thank you note. Thank them for the opportunity.
